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
MICROPROCESADORES
Natalia Cardona Gómez - 1015008
Nidia Alejandra Cifuentes Rodríguez - 1015012
Luisa Fernanda Velásquez González - 1015060
1
¿QUÉ ES UN MICROPROCESADOR?
Un microprocesador es un circuito que
constituye la unidad central de
procesamiento (CPU) de una computadora. Es
el encargado de proporcionar las
operaciones del cálculo, da órdenes y
envía información al resto de la
computadora. Los microprocesadores se
utilizan, en ordenadores pero también en
otros sistemas informáticos avanzados,
como impresoras, automóviles o aviones.
2
HISTORIA
Para fabricar los ordenadores personales hacía
falta un procesador mucho más pequeño, el
microprocesador: es un circuito sumamente
integrado, es decir un microchip. El microchip es
un circuito electrónico complejo cuyos componentes
son diminutos y forman una sola pieza plana muy
fina y semiconductora.
3
LÍNEA DEL TIEMPO
Según muchos Intel Corporation creó el primer
microprocesador de la historia. Por esta razón la
historia de Intel y la de los microprocesadores van
tan ligadas.
1971.
puede ser empleado para controlar computadoras.
Con 4 chips como este y dos chips más de
memoria se diseñó el primer microprocesador de
Intel, el 4004.
6
NOMBRE AÑO FRECUENCIA DE RELOJ DE LA CPU.
7
NOMBRE AÑO FRECUENCIA DE RELOJ DE LA CPU.
Intel 386 DX 1985 16 MHz a 33 MHz
8
NOMBRE AÑO FRECUENCIA DE RELOJ DE LA CPU.
9
NOMBRE AÑO FRECUENCIA DE RELOJ DE LA CPU.
AMD Athlon 1999 700 MHz a 2,5 GHz
10
NOMBRE AÑO FRECUENCIA DE RELOJ DE LA CPU.
AMD Phenom 2008 2,1 GHz
11
NOMBRE AÑO FRECUENCIA DE RELOJ DE LA CPU.
AMD FX 2012 3,8 GHz a 4,1 GHz
12
Intel 8080 - 1974
Zilog Z80 - 1976 Intel 386SX - 1988
14
OTROS FABRICANTES DE MICROPROCESADORES
Apple, Motorola,
Cyrix, Sun
Microsystems,
Digital Equipment 5%
Corporation, Compaq,
IBM y AMD son las
principales empresas 15%
que se dedican
también a la 80%
fabricación de
microprocesadores.
15
SECCIONES DEL MICROPROCESADOR:
● ALU: unidad aritmético-lógica que hace cálculos con
números y toma decisiones lógicas.
● Registros: zonas de memoria especiales para almacenar
información temporalmente.
● Unidad de control: descodifica los programas.
● Bus: transportan información digital (en bits) a
través del chip.
● Memoria local: utilizada para los cómputos efectuados
en el mismo chip.
● Memoria cache: memoria especializada que sirve para
acelerar el acceso a los dispositivos externos de
almacenamiento de datos.
● Puertos: comunicación del microprocesador con el
mundo exterior.
16
¿DE QUÉ MATERIAL ESTÁN FABRICADOS LOS MICROPROCESADORES?
Principalmente se fabrican de silicio. Este se funde y va
formando un cristal que se corta para formar un cilindro,
el cual se rebana en obleas de 10 micras de espesor.
18
RENDIMIENTO DE LOS MICROPROCESADORES.
Una forma de medir la potencia de un procesador es mediante la obtención de instrucciones
por ciclo.
Las IPC son la cantidad de instrucciones que ejecuta un procesador por un ciclo reloj.
Normalmente se trata de un valor medio, ya que la cantidad de instrucciones ejecutadas en
un ciclo de reloj en la mayoría de la microarquitectura de procesadores varía en función
del programa ejecutado en el procesador.
Ej: La suma de números enteros se ejecuta más rápido que la suma de números reales.
A través de la frecuencia también puede ser medido el rendimiento, con la condición de que
los procesadores tengan arquitecturas similares. Sin embargo de una familia de
procesadores es común encontrar distintas frecuencia reloj, debido a que no todos los chip
de silicio tienen los mismos límites de funcionamiento, son probados a distintas
frecuencias, hasta que muestran signos de inestabilidad.
19
RENDIMIENTO DE LOS MICROPROCESADORES.
A la hora de medir el rendimiento de un procesador se calcula el tiempo que tarda en
ejecutar un programa. Este tiempo se obtiene con la siguiente fórmula:
20
APLICACIÓN DE LOS MICROPROCESADORES EN LA AVIONICA
21
PC7448
Microprocesador que se caracteriza
por su alto rendimiento.
Microprocesador superescalar con
un bus de datos de 32 bits y
memoria caché de 1 Megabyte. Su
frecuencia de trabajo oscila entre
1 y 1,25 Ghz su aplicación en el
campo de la aviónica se refleja en
el diseño de radares y de las
pantallas que se usan dentro de la
cabina.
22
PC8641D
Sus características principales
son un alto rendimiento y una
latencia muy baja entre el
microprocesador y la memoria
caché. Este implementa una
estructura de doble núcleo con
caché individual para cada uno de
ellos su frecuencia de trabajo
llega hasta 1,5 Ghz y se utiliza
para diseñar los ordenadores de a
bordo de los aviones.
23
APLICACIONES DE LOS MICROPROCESADORES.
Se ilustra conforme aumenta el nivel de complejidad en el uso de los
microprocesadores, también se incrementa el costo en las unidades.
● Los primeros
microprocesadores se
crearon de acuerdo a la
arquitectura de Von
Neumann.
25
ARQUITECTURA INTERNA DEL MICROPROCESADOR
En el diseño conceptual y la estructura operacional fundamental de un
sistema de computadora, se proporciona una descripción de construcción y
distribución física de los componentes:
26
ARQUITECTURA INTERNA DEL MICROPROCESADOR PENTIUM
Intel Pentium es una gama de
microprocesadores de quinta generación con
arquitectura x86 producidos por Intel
Corporation.
Estos microprocesadores tienen modos de
funcionamiento:
Modo protegido: Es el estado nativo de un
microprocesador y ofrece un alto nivel de
rendimiento y capacidad.
Dirección modo real: Proporciona el entorno
de programación del procesador intel 8086.
Sistema de gestión de modo (SMM): Ofrece un
sistema operativo y la aplicación
independiente y transparente mecanismo para
aplicar el sistema de gestión de energía.
27
28
Actualmente
distinguimos entre: PROCESADORES MONONÚCLEO
29
PROCESADORES MULTINÚCLEO
30
ARQUITECTURA EXTERNA DEL MICROPROCESADOR
El bus principal:
31
CARACTERÍSTICAS AVANZADAS
● El procesador obtiene la dirección de destino antes que la instrucción
se ejecute en la rama apropiada.
● Doble 8 KB de caché. Uno para instrucciones y otro para datos.
● Write-Back chaché (pequeña memoria de alta velocidad utilizada en
ordenadores para aumentar la velocidad de ejecución de código en línea.
Está situado entre el procesador central y la memoria principal), sólo
los datos en el caché de datos cuando se cambian, se modifican.
● 64 bits de bus.
● Ha sido optimizado para ejecutar instrucciones en menos de un ciclo
reloj.
32
PROCESADOR 80386
33
PROCESADOR 80486
34
CICLO DE INSTRUCCIONES Y PIPELINE
Sin pipelining:
35
Con pipelining:
36
BIBLIOGRAFIA
● https://line.do/es/linea-de-tiempo-de-los-microprocesadores/zc6/vertica
● http://www.maestrosdelweb.com/historia-de-los-microprocesadores/
● http://www.alegsa.com.ar/Diccionario/C/26167.php
● http://www2.electron.frba.utn.edu.ar/~gjoyuela/presentaciones/Procesador%
20IA-32%20-%20Clase4.pdf microprocesadores/
● http://www.alegsa.com.ar/Diccionario/C/26167.php
37
Gracias
😄
38